Student loans create financial obligations that can span decades. If you die before repaying them, the impact depends on the loan type: federal loans may be discharged, but private loans and co-signed debt typically transfer to the co-signer. Life insurance protects against this risk.

Steps for Germantown Residents When Taking on Student Loans
Practical steps to ensure your coverage matches your new circumstances in Germantown.
Inventory all student loans, distinguishing between federal and private, and identifying any co-signers.
Calculate the total private loan balance that would fall to co-signers if you pass away.
Consider a term policy with a duration matching your expected loan repayment timeline.
If you are a co-signer on a child's student loans, evaluate whether your child has coverage.
Review coverage as loans are paid down to ensure you are not over-insured.

Term Life Insurance
A 10 to 20-year term matching the loan repayment period provides affordable, targeted protection for co-signers.
